How to Fix a Upvc Door Locking Mechanism
There are numerous reasons why a Upvc door locking mechanism might not function properly. It could be a loose or Upvc Front Doors Supplied And Fitted Near Me damaged lock, a broken hinge or misalignment. An intruder can also cause damage.
Adjusting the butt hinges
If you have an upvc doors near me door and it is not locking properly you might need to adjust the hinges on butts. To do this, you must open the door and remove the caps protecting the door. Then you'll need to turn the adjustment slot by turning the pins clockwise as well as counterclockwise.
Begin by adjusting the door's level before you adjust the uPVC hinges. You can make use of a level or an eraser pen to mark the beginning point. When the door is level you can move the adjusters at the top and bottom.
Depending on the uPVC door model, you might need to take off the caps to expose the slot. To accomplish this, you'll need a Phillips or cross-head screwdriver. After you've removed the caps then loosen the screws and remove the caps on the slot.
Next, you'll need first, an Allen key. Most uPVC doors only have one adjustment slot per hinge. Some uPVC door models require the use of an Allen key. Other models don't have adjustment slots.
Usually, butt hinges can be found on older uPVC door models. You can find newer designs that allow side to side movement. Some older butt hinges require cross-heads or a Phillips screwdriver.
Flag hinges can be adjusted on uPVC doors. They offer two kinds of adjustments: height and compression. Each hinge comes with an attached pin that runs through its top. This adjustment lets you open or close your door vertically, horizontally, or both.
Some upvc replacement door handles doors come with the ability to adjust the lateral angle. This adjustment lets you move the hinge closer to the jamb. Typically, this is hidden behind a plastic cover.
